Hi
In the P3D version of the C152 hours were maintained between flights. In the X-Plane version the hours go back to zero. Is this a bug or limitation in X-Plane? Thanks Dave

Hmm, we've had a couple reports of this. Thanks for the additional report; I'm taking a look to see if I can reproduce it. So far the Hobbs meter correctly saves the hours between flights for me, so I'm not yet sure what's causing it.
I'll keep working on it! EDIT: I believe I have isolated it as an X-Plane bug: the AI aircraft's Hobbs value overwrites the player's Hobbs value. I have reported this to Laminar. The solution for now is to disable all AI aircraft. :)

Thanks.
An interim fix is to save a scenario before quiting and reload the scenario when you next use the aircraft. |
